Arduino UNO R4 - DHT11 - OLED
In diesem Leitfaden lernen wir, Temperatur und Luftfeuchtigkeit mit einem DHT11-Modul zu messen und die Messwerte auf einem OLED-Bildschirm anzuzeigen.

Erforderliche Hardware
Oder Sie können die folgenden Kits kaufen:
| 1 | × | DIYables STEM V4 IoT Starter-Kit (Arduino enthalten) | |
| 1 | × | DIYables Sensor-Kit (30 Sensoren/Displays) | |
| 1 | × | DIYables Sensor-Kit (18 Sensoren/Displays) |
Über OLED-Display, DHT11 Temperatur- und Feuchtigkeitssensor
Erfahren Sie mehr über OLED-Displays und DHT11-Temperatur- und Feuchtigkeitssensoren (deren Einrichtung, Funktionen und Programmierung) in den untenstehenden Tutorials:
- Arduino UNO R4 - OLED tutorial
- Arduino UNO R4 - DHT11 tutorial
Verdrahtungsdiagramm

Dieses Bild wurde mit Fritzing erstellt. Klicken Sie, um das Bild zu vergrößern.
Siehe Der beste Weg, den Arduino Uno R4 und andere Komponenten mit Strom zu versorgen.
Arduino UNO R4 Programmcode - DHT11-Sensor - OLED
Schnelle Schritte
Folgen Sie diesen Anweisungen Schritt für Schritt:
- Wenn Sie das Arduino Uno R4 WiFi/Minima zum ersten Mal verwenden, lesen Sie das Tutorial zur Einrichtung der Umgebung für Arduino Uno R4 WiFi/Minima in der Arduino IDE.
- Verbinden Sie die Arduino Uno R4-Platine gemäß dem bereitgestellten Diagramm mit dem DHT11-Temperatur- und Feuchtigkeitssensor-Modul sowie dem OLED-Display.
- Verbinden Sie die Arduino Uno R4-Platine über ein USB-Kabel mit Ihrem Computer.
- Öffnen Sie die Arduino IDE auf Ihrem Computer.
- Wählen Sie das passende Arduino Uno R4-Board (z. B. Arduino Uno R4 WiFi) und den COM-Port aus.
- Gehen Sie zum Bibliotheken-Symbol auf der linken Seite der Arduino IDE.
- Geben Sie im Suchfeld 'SSD1306' ein und suchen Sie anschließend nach der SSD1306-Bibliothek von Adafruit.
- Drücken Sie die Schaltfläche Installieren, um die Bibliothek hinzuzufügen.

- Sie müssen zusätzliche Bibliotheksabhängigkeiten installieren.
- Klicken Sie auf die Schaltfläche Alle installieren, um alle Bibliotheksabhängigkeiten zu installieren.

- Suchen Sie nach „DHT“, dann finden Sie die von Adafruit erstellte DHT-Sensor-Bibliothek.
- Drücken Sie auf die Installieren-Schaltfläche, um die Bibliothek hinzuzufügen.

- Sie müssen zusätzliche Bibliotheksabhängigkeiten installieren.
- Klicken Sie auf die Alle installieren Schaltfläche, um alle Bibliotheksabhängigkeiten zu installieren.

- Kopieren Sie den obigen Code und öffnen Sie ihn in der Arduino-IDE
- Klicken Sie auf die Hochladen-Schaltfläche in der oberen Anleitung von Arduino Tooltip, um den Code auf Ihren Arduino UNO R4 hochzuladen
- Platzieren Sie den Sensor in heißem und kaltem Wasser oder halten Sie ihn in der Hand
- Überprüfen Sie die Ergebnisse auf dem OLED-Display und im seriellen Monitor
※ Notiz:
Der Code zentriert den Text automatisch horizontal und vertikal auf dem OLED-Display.
Video Tutorial
Wir erwägen die Erstellung von Video-Tutorials. Wenn Sie Video-Tutorials für wichtig halten, abonnieren Sie bitte unseren YouTube-Kanal , um uns zu motivieren, die Videos zu erstellen.